TL;DR Summary

Mercedes performs strongly in Montreal with George Russell and Kimi Antonelli leading in both single lap and long run times, thanks to optimal tyre temperature management. The team’s new rear suspension appears promising, and despite mixed performances from Red Bull and McLaren, the overall pace suggests a competitive weekend. Ferrari faces setbacks after Leclerc's crash, while Williams shows potential with competitive long run times. The focus remains on tyre management and qualifying strategies.
